Young Gold Coast United attacker Tahj Minniecon is out to prove doubters wrong and is looking forward to match day one of the 2009/2010 A-League season.
Minniecon signed with the new club from Queensland Roar who he believes did not do enough to retain his services.
"There is definitely a point to prove on my behalf," he told the Brisbane Times.
"To be honest, I believe I have a lot more to show."
After leaving the Roar - who are now experiencing financial difficulty - Minniecon feels blessed the move happened when it did.
I feel lucky and satisfied to have moved when I did," he added.
"It's a new challenge. I needed something new - I was getting a bit too comfortable at Brisbane."
